Green tea's catechins — EGCG chief among them — are associated in trials with a small rise in fat oxidation and daily energy expenditure. Small is the honest word for it, not dramatic.
Much of that effect is tied to the caffeine that naturally accompanies the catechins, which is worth knowing if you're sensitive to caffeine or already drink coffee.
